Participants spoke to reporters about a recent report indicating that many criminals accused of torture were living freely in the U.S. and had not been prosecuted by federal officials. They also talked about several of the persons listed in the report and criticized the government for maintaining a double standard in their efforts to combat terrorism. Following their remarks they answered questions from the reporters. close
